cp: work around linux kernel bug: short-read != EOF on /proc
Remove the optimization that avoided up to 50% of cp's read syscalls. Do not assume that a short read on a regular file indicates EOF. When reading from a file in /proc on linux [at least 2.6.9 - 2.6.29] into a 4k-byte buffer or larger, a short read does not always indicate EOF. For example, "cp /proc/slabinfo /tmp" copies only 4068 of the total 7493 bytes. This optimization (25719a33154f0c62ea9881f0c79ae312dd4cec7a, Improve performance a bit by optimizing away; 2005-11-24) appears to have been worth less than a 2% speed-up (and usually much less), so the impact of removing it is negligible. * src/copy.c (copy_reg): Don't exit the loop early. * tests/cp/proc-short-read: New test, lightly based on a suggestion from Mike Frysinger, to exercise this fix. * tests/Makefile.am (TESTS): Add cp/proc-short-read. * NEWS (Improve robustness): Mention this change.
